The Rise of Personal Mobility Devices in Urban Transportation

In recent years, urban centers worldwide have witnessed a significant transformation in how individuals navigate congested, often chaotic cityscapes. The traditional reliance on automobiles, public transit, and biking is increasingly complemented—or even replaced—by a new wave of personal mobility devices. These innovations not only address environmental concerns but also reflect a broader shift toward flexible, lightweight, and user-centric transportation solutions.

Emergence and Industry Insights

According to industry reports, the global micromobility market, which includes electric scooters, bikes, and other compact personal vehicles, is projected to reach $300 billion USD by 2030, up from approximately $10 billion USD in 2020. This exponential growth underscores the urgent need for accessible, efficient, and smart mobility platforms that cater to urban dwellers’ needs.

Device Type Market Share (2023) Major Developers
Electric Scooters 45% Lime, Bird, Spin
Electric Bikes 35% Rad Power Bikes, VanMoof
Personal E-Boards & Skates 10% Boosted, Meepo
Emerging Devices 10% Various startups

The proliferation of these devices is driven by technological advancements—compact batteries, IoT connectivity, and user-friendly apps—that enable seamless integration into daily routines.

The Role of Smart Mobility Applications

As these devices evolve, the importance of intelligent mobility platforms becomes paramount. They serve as the command centers for users to locate, unlock, and pay for rentals—all from their smartphones. This integration simplifies urban transportation, reduces reliance on private vehicles, and contributes to the reduction of carbon emissions.

Challenges and Future Outlook

Despite the promising trajectory, challenges related to regulation, safety, and device maintenance persist. Cities are exploring innovative policies to integrate micromobility into existing transportation infrastructure while ensuring rider safety and equitable access.

Looking ahead, the fusion of AI, IoT, and sustainable hardware will further enhance these platforms, making personal mobility more intuitive and efficient.
